1kg Coffee Beans – How Much Coffee Is In One Kilo Bag? A kilo worth of coffee beans will make about 140 cups. This estimate is based upon the industry standard of seven grams per coffee cup and assumes that there isn't any waste. However, the taste of a drink and the method of brewing can significantly alter this number. To get a precise measurement, you can use a digital scale. Whether you're an espresso enthusiast or a casual drip brewer, you're likely to have an idea of how much one kilogram of coffee beans can make. However, calculating the amount of cups can be tricky as it is based on factors like grind size, brewing method, and individual preference. In general, a kilogram of beans will produce about 100 cups if ground fine for a drip brewer or an Aeropress. If you're using a French press that will produce around 70 cups. It is possible to try experimenting to determine the ideal size of grind.
